Design of freeform reflector array for oblique illumination in general lighting

Abstract: Downloaded From: http://opticalengineering.spiedigitallibrary.org/ on 08/15/2015 Terms of Use: http://spiedigitallibrary.org/ss/TermsOfUse.aspxAbstract. With increasing concerns about light pollution and energy waste in general lighting, efficient and effective lighting techniques have become imperative. We present the design of a kind of dedicated oblique illumination (OI) system to solve the problems of light pollution and the waste of energy in general lighting. The OI system consists of an extended (actual… Show more

“…[16][17][18] Therefore, engineering concepts such as geometrical overlapping and arrangement of light sources, usage of multiple-curvature lenses or reflector concepts can be deployed to increase the uniformity of illumination across the screening area. [19][20][21][22][23] Ensuring uniform illumination over larger areas depicts a tremendous challenge. 24,25 Since the activity of a photochemical system scales in a linear fashion with the absorbed photon flux within the photon limited regime of a photoreaction, screening setups must be at least sufficiently characterized from a photonic standpoint to take irradiation inhomogeneities into account.…”

“…The application of freeform reflectors is one suited concept for engineering irradiance uniformity over relatively large areas. 23,53,54 Commercially available materials such as PTFE offer good diffuse reflectivity and are therefore particularly suited as reflector materials. 55 In addition, even relatively thin PTFE sheets already assure high and even reflectivity over the UV/vis range (see Fig.…”
